Here's the situation:

On 02/25/09, I purchased a (new) Hipshot bridge on eBay for a bass that is being built for me. The auction was a "buy it now" format, with fixed price and fixed shipping. I paid via PayPal immediately. The listing stated "10 or more available", so the assumption is that the item was in stock and ready to go, and the seller had a good feedback rating, with no reason for any concern.

Yesterday, 03/06/09, I suddenly realized....."Where the heck is my bridge?" It had been 9 days, and I had not received the shipment, nor had I received any communication from the seller whatsoever (other than an automated response that my order was being processed). I should note, the seller is in Indiana, and I'm in West Virginia, so even with the slowest of shipping times, it should only take a few days. I decided to email the seller to inquire. 9 days later, and the seller had not even shipped! 9 days later, and no communication from the seller at all, until I emailed to inquire! I have to wonder what may have happened if I hadn't emailed to ask what's up!

So here's the question:

Assuming I actually receive the bridge in the next few days, in the condition described in the listing (new), what sort of feedback does this seller deserve? I'm not one to give negative feedback unless it is ENTIRELY justified, but at the same time, I feel that this seller absolutely does not deserve positive feedback of any kind.

What does TalkBass think?

Here are the 4 categories for detailed feedback:
  • Item as described
  • Communication
  • Shipping time
  • Shipping and handling charges
I agree with you, only 1 star for shipping time. No communication whatsoever, so in my opinion, that only gets 1 star.

The shipping charges were reasonable, and if we assume that the item arrives as described, that still means that 2 out of 4 categories were terrible.

50% is rarely considered a passing grade.

Am I making too much of this?
